Output 70629736048836bcfdbe7e84b8013c4303dd5d6558a74d744464384953a41d79:3
- value
- 2989496
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 62c03b89035f167aaf79b65ffeadce9ce1ab4086 OP_EQUAL
- address
- 3AhARttn4VkeHAGdTxKiZGAX17snT2x9vn
- transaction
- 70629736048836bcfdbe7e84b8013c4303dd5d6558a74d744464384953a41d79
- spent
- true